Output 32c9160818eb6c64a84a0e68bedda65e2734c73994ff5f8b458ee244f11a8b67:14

value
21867200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80adc7221d120a68c74b0d14d6a07952debdfce5 OP_EQUAL
address
3DRQbPuWCZkw4oRFxWFwXVaamdELaBhzET
transaction
32c9160818eb6c64a84a0e68bedda65e2734c73994ff5f8b458ee244f11a8b67
spent
true